Curbside Pickup pitches free ordering platform for small businesses

Jul. 27, 2026
By AI, Created 04:58 UTC, Jul 27, 2026, AGP -

Curbside Pickup says its platform helps retailers, restaurants and service businesses manage curbside, in-store and dine-in orders from one app while cutting congestion and improving efficiency. The company is offering a free plan with no upfront costs as it targets businesses that want digital ordering without added complexity.

Why it matters: - Curbside Pickup is targeting businesses that need faster ordering and pickup without adding more labor or complexity. - The platform is designed to help businesses increase throughput, serve more customers and improve profitability using existing staff and infrastructure. - The offering may be especially relevant for small businesses that have been slow to adopt digital ordering because of cost or setup barriers.

What happened: - Curbside Pickup said on July 27, 2026, that it is offering a platform for curbside pickup, in-store pickup and dine-in ordering through a single business app. - The platform is aimed at businesses in retail, hospitality and service industries. - The company said the system helps manage every incoming order through the Curbside Pickup Business application. - More information is available at curbsidepickup.io.

The details: - Businesses can receive orders before customers arrive, allowing staff to prepare in advance and reduce front-counter congestion. - Automated notifications in the business app tell employees when orders need preparing and when customers have arrived. - The platform is built to help businesses fulfill more orders during peak periods without adding staff or making major operational changes. - Curbside pickup can expand access for customers who prefer not to leave their vehicles, including people with disabilities, parents with young children and customers needing immediate service. - The system includes reporting and analytics tools that can show best-selling products, peak trading periods and customer purchasing patterns. - Those insights can help businesses adjust menus, inventory, staffing and broader strategy. - The platform is intended for businesses ranging from independent cafés and retailers to pharmacies, grocery stores, florists, butcher shops, cloud kitchens and larger hospitality groups. - Businesses can start on a free plan with no upfront costs, contracts or credit card requirements. - Pricing is tiered so businesses pay more as order volume grows.
